Temperature sensed by Freezestat
which cancels compressor shutdown
Time alloted which will also cancel
compressor shutdown
"Lead Only" or "Both" also available
Control voltage supplied from wall-
mount unit control boards to blower in
heat
Control voltage supplied from wall-
mount unit control boards to blower in
regular DC free cooling
Control voltage supplied from wall-
mount unit control boards to blower in
low ambient condition DC free cooling
Control voltage supplied from wall-
mount unit control boards to blower in
mechanical cooling
Temperature at which control separates
two (2) different low pressure situations
This differential applies to the outside
setpoint
Any low pressure situation above the
outside setpoint will be delayed 120

seconds before an alarm is initialized

Any low pressure situation below the
outside setpoint will be delayed 180
seconds before an alarm is initialized
Once stopped, the compressor remains
inactive for this period of time
Once started, the compressor remains
on for this period of time
Startup delay on power cycle
Minimum run time for first stage of two-
stage compressors
Failures/amount of time before the
system is locked-out in HVAC fail mode
Amount of time switch is open before
compressor is temporarily disabled in
soft lockout
Recent amount of failures
